Job Details:
The Director, Information Technology plays a pivotal role in shaping an organization's technological landscape, driving digital transformation, and ensuring that IT capabilities support and enhance business operations and competitive advantage.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
Regulatory Compliance and Standards: Ensure compliance with regulatory requirements and industry standards, safeguarding the organization's IT practices and data security.
Long-Term IT Strategy: Define and execute the long-term IT strategy, ensuring it is aligned with organizational objectives and drives business growth.
Leadership and Team Development: Lead and develop the entire IT organization, fostering a culture of innovation, excellence, and continuous improvement.
IT Operations Oversight: Oversee all IT operations, including infrastructure, applications, security, and support, ensuring seamless performance and scalability.
Collaboration with C-Level Executives: Collaborate with C-level executives to drive digital transformation initiatives, ensuring alignment with business goals and market demands.
Team Member Support and Empowerment: Actively support team members by identifying and creating opportunities for skill development, cross-functional exposure, and career advancement, ensuring their success and alignment with organizational goals.
Budget and Resource Management: Manage the IT budget and resource allocation across the department, optimizing cost efficiency and project outcomes.
Perform other job-related duties as assigned, which align with our organization's vision, mission, and values and fall within your scope of practice.
Qualifications:
Education: Bachelor's, Master’s degree, preferably in Information Technology, Computer Science, or a significant amount of relevant experience.
Preferred Certification(s): Any relevant IT certification along with ITIL knowledge.
Experience: 10+ years of relevant and progressive experience with a proven ability to lead and motivate teams.

Position Specific Skills:
Provide strategic direction and leadership for the Service Desk, Deskside Support, Client Engineering, and Collaboration Tools teams
Foster a culture of continuous improvement, collaboration, and customer focus within the organization
Strong knowledge of Microsoft technologies and contract management.
Manage the implementation and support of collaboration tools, including Microsoft Teams, SharePoint, and other communication platforms.
Promote the adoption and effective use of collaboration tools to enhance productivity and teamwork.
Ensure the delivery of secure, reliable, and scalable client solutions that meet the needs of the organization.
Stay current with emerging technologies and industry trends to drive innovation in client engineering.
Collaborate with the managed service provider to ensure seamless execution of day-to-day IT operations.
Monitor and assess the performance of the managed service provider, ensuring adherence to SLAs, quality, and delivery standards.
